Easy Honey Garlic Salmon and Shrimp Bowl

Easy Honey Garlic Salmon and Shrimp Bowl for Quick Weeknight Wins

This Easy Honey Garlic Salmon and Shrimp Bowl is a quick and flavorful weeknight dinner, featuring tender salmon and juicy shrimp in a sweet-savory sauce.
Prep Time 10 minutes
Cook Time 20 minutes
Total Time 30 minutes
Course dinner
Cuisine Tropical
Servings 4 bowls
Calories 400 kcal

Equipment

  • - Large skillet

Ingredients
  

For the Sauce

  • 2 tablespoons Honey substitute with maple syrup for a vegan option
  • 3 cloves Garlic minced
  • 1 tablespoon Ginger grated, fresh recommended
  • 1/4 teaspoon Cayenne Pepper adjust to preference
  • 1/4 teaspoon Red Pepper Flakes optional, use according to taste
  • 1 teaspoon Smoked Paprika

For Cooking

  • 2 tablespoons Olive Oil any neutral oil works
  • to taste Salt
  • to taste Black Pepper
  • 2 tablespoons Unsalted Butter substitute with olive oil for dairy-free

For the Proteins

  • 1 pound Shrimp peeled and deveined
  • 1 pound Wild-Caught Salmon cut into uniform chunks

For the Creamy Finish

  • 1 cup Coconut Cream full-fat for richness
  • 1/4 cup Cilantro fresh, for garnish

Instructions
 

Prep Ingredients

  • Peel and devein the shrimp. Cut the salmon into uniform chunks. In separate bowls, mix honey, minced garlic, grated ginger, cayenne pepper, smoked paprika, and seasoning.

Cook Shrimp

  • Heat olive oil over medium-high heat in a large skillet. Add shrimp and cook for 2-3 minutes per side until pink and opaque. Remove and set aside.

Cook Salmon

  • Using the same skillet, cook the salmon chunks for 3-4 minutes until golden crust forms. Remove and set aside with the shrimp.

Make Sauce

  • Lower heat and add unsalted butter to the pan. Once melted, deglaze the skillet with leftover marinade. Let simmer briefly, then return shrimp and salmon.

Finish Sauce

  • Stir in the coconut cream, warming until sauce slightly thickens. Adjust seasoning with salt, pepper, or spice level as needed.

Serve

  • Transfer mixture to bowls, garnish with fresh cilantro, and serve warm.

Notes

Optional: Serve over jasmine rice or alongside steamed vegetables for a complete meal.
